Geologists and vulcanologists have been saying for years that tourist visits there were a disaster waiting to happen. When you poke the tiger enough times, you'll eventually get bitten.
I'm no geology expert. On one hand, the alert level was raised to the highest level short of an eruption on 11/18 because of increasing volcanic activity on the island. One may reasonably question why tours were still allowed given the heightened alert. At the same time, other geologists say there was no indication of an imminent violent eruption, despite the heightened alert level.
I've visited White Island. It's one of the coolest places I've ever been, and I wouldn't hesitate to visit any more than I would hesitate to visit earthquake-prone California (which, incidentally, has killed 130 people and injured 14,000 in the last 30 years).
